Gifted Unlimited Rhymes Universal (GURU): Rest in Peace

VANCOUVER — Rapper Guru, who co-founded the band Gang Starr, is dead at 43.

The musician, who mixed rap with jazz stylings, succumbed to cancer Monday night, his management said. His real name was Keith Elam.

The rapper had suffered from cancer for over a year.

MTV said in a release: “According to [producer] Solar, Guru suffered from the malicious illness for over a year and after numerous special treatments under the supervision of medical specialists failed, the legendary MC succumbed to the disease. Guru always tried to keep this harrowing diagnosis in private but in early 2010 he had to admit himself to hospital due to serious effects caused by the disease.”

Guru and DJ Premier founded Gang Starr in 1985, producing six albums. The two had a falling out and Guru went on to make solo albums.
